- Setting the shared national agenda of Israel and the Jewish People, together with the Partnerships (Jewish Peoplehood, the younger generation, aliyah and immigrant absorption, the Negev and the Galilee, education and employment, etc.).
- Joint planning and mutual study of successes and failures in similar spheres of activity (conducting conferences and exchanging information about successes and failures in various endeavors such as school twinning, economic development, community volunteer groups, women's leadership and the like).
- Helping to build Partnership coalitions for common issues and/or region oriented activity and community building.
- Coordination and integration of core Jewish Agency activities conducted in the Regions by Partnership 2000.
- Helping to establish equitable, reciprocal and egalitarian contact between Partners in Israel and the Diaspora (honest broker).
- Helping to form optimal Partnership 2000 Steering Committees (leaders from the Regions and Partnered Communities - including both elected representatives and volunteer civic figures; personalities from outside the Partnership Regions and so on).
- Providing effective, high-quality, bureaucracy-free services (for decision making, project management, financial transfer, monitoring and fiscal control).
- Encouraging the Partners to increase investment in the Partnership (both the Diaspora Jewish Communities and the local authorities in Israel).
- Rallying the Israel Government's professional and material support for Partnership 2000 projects.
- Integrating Israel's business, volunteer and philanthropic sectors in Partnerships.
